RUMORED BUZZ ON WHAT IS MD5'S APPLICATION

Rumored Buzz on what is md5's application

Rumored Buzz on what is md5's application

Blog Article

Usually, the passwords you use on your own favorites Web sites are certainly not stored in basic text. These are initial hashed for protection factors.

This method goes inside of a loop for 16 operations. Each time, the inputs stipulated previously mentioned are applied for his or her respective Procedure. The 17th operation is the start of the second round, and the process carries on equally, other than the G purpose is made use of instead.

Having said that, eventually, vulnerabilities in MD5 turned evident, leading to its deprecation in favor of more secure algorithms like SHA-256. Inspite of its weaknesses, MD5 remains to be utilized in some legacy systems as a consequence of its effectiveness and relieve of implementation, while its use in protection-sensitive applications is now generally discouraged.

You don’t want any hardware to start, just a few suggestions I give Within this book. Whenever you’re Completely ready For additional protection, Allow me to share factors you ought to take into consideration:

MD5 has historically been Employed in digital signatures and certificates. A digital signature commonly requires creating a hash of the message after which you can encrypting that hash with A non-public key to crank out a signature. The recipient can then validate the signature by decrypting it using the sender’s general public crucial and evaluating it With all the hash of the first concept. Nevertheless, as a consequence of MD5’s vulnerability to collision attacks, it is actually not encouraged to utilize MD5 for electronic signatures or certificates in Cybersecurity Instruction Classes .

Regardless of its recognition, MD5 continues to be found to obtain many vulnerabilities that make it unsuitable to be used in password hashing.

Tests and Validation: Carefully take a look at The brand new authentication solutions inside of a managed ecosystem to make sure they click here functionality correctly and securely.

This time, we’ll be zeroing in on what actually takes place when facts goes through the MD5 hashing algorithm. How can a thing like “They are deterministic” (This can be merely a random sentence we Employed in the other report) get was a 128-little bit hash like this?

Because of this two documents with wholly various articles won't ever contain the exact same MD5 digest, which makes it hugely not likely for somebody to produce a pretend file that matches the original digest.

In scenarios the place the Preliminary enter and its padding are larger than 1 512-little bit block, the numbering plan resets. When the first block of information has become processed, the 2nd block’s inputs will also be labelled M0 through to M15

In the situation in which the remaining enter information is precisely 448 bits extensive, a complete additional block would want being additional for that padding. The second-previous block would come with the final 448 bits of knowledge, then a a single, accompanied by sixty three zeros to replenish the block.

Concept Digest Calculation: The padded enter information is divided into 512-little bit blocks, in addition to a series of rational features, bitwise functions, and rotations are applied to Every block in a certain get. This method updates The inner variables and produces the final 128-bit hash price.

Following the shift has long been manufactured, the result of every one of these calculations is additional to the worth for initialization vector B. Originally, it’s 89abcdef, however it improvements in subsequent operations.

MD5 was formulated by Ronald Rivest in 1991 being an advancement over earlier hash functions. It had been intended to be rapid and economical, generating a unique fingerprint for digital information.

Report this page